Post

Cybersecurity for Beginners: A Practical Roadmap to Start Your Career

A beginner-friendly, step-by-step guide to starting a career in cybersecurity. Learn fundamentals, hands-on labs, certifications, and community resources.

Cybersecurity for Beginners: A Practical Roadmap to Start Your Career

Overview

Cybersecurity is one of the fastest-growing and most in-demand technology careers today. From protecting personal data to defending organizations against large-scale cyberattacks, cybersecurity professionals play a critical role in the digital world.

If you’re a beginner wondering how to start a career in cybersecurity, this guide provides a clear, practical roadmap—from building fundamentals to hands-on practice, certifications, and community involvement.


Why Cybersecurity?

Every organization today—whether a bank, university, or startup—relies on technology. With this dependence comes the constant threat of cyberattacks. That’s why cybersecurity professionals are needed everywhere.

Beyond job demand, the field offers variety. You can explore areas like ethical hacking, digital forensics, SOC operations, OSINT, malware analysis, and more.


Step 1: Build a Strong Foundation

Before diving into hacking tools and advanced techniques, get comfortable with the basics:

  • Computer Networks – TCP/IP, DNS, firewalls, VPNs
  • Operating Systems – Linux and Windows administration
  • Programming & Scripting – Python, Bash, C/C++ for automation and analysis

Step 2: Learn Security Fundamentals

Once you have the basics, start focusing on core cybersecurity concepts:

  • Cryptography
  • Web application security
  • Common vulnerabilities (SQL injection, XSS, buffer overflows)
  • Security policies and risk management

A must-read resource is the OWASP Top 10.


Step 3: Get Hands-On

Cybersecurity skills are built through practice.

Practice Platforms

Home Lab & Tools

Common tools worth learning:


Step 4: Certifications (Free, Paid & Advanced)

Certifications help validate your knowledge and show commitment.

Free Certifications / Courses



Advanced Certifications


Step 5: Join the Community

Cybersecurity is community-driven, and learning accelerates when you connect with others:


Step 6: Keep Practicing & Stay Curious

Cybersecurity is not a one-time learning path. New vulnerabilities and attack techniques appear constantly.

Consistency matters more than speed.


Final Thoughts

If you’re just starting out, don’t feel overwhelmed. Learn step by step, practice regularly, and accept failure as part of the process.

Cybersecurity is not just a career—it’s a responsibility to help make the digital world safer.


This post is licensed under CC BY 4.0 by the author.